If its perimeter of an equilateral triangle is 180 cm, what will be its area​

Answer:

Perimeter of △ABC= 180cm. So the side of an equilateral triangle is 60cm. Area of the equilateral triangle is given as Area = √34x2 where x is the side of the equilateral triangle. Hence the area of the triangle is 1558.84cm2.
